Neighborhood Overview

Victoria is a small, welcoming community located in Ellis County, Kansas, situated just off Interstate 70. The school is centrally located within the town, making it easy to access via main thoroughfares like 10th Street. Most visitors arrive by car, as the area is largely rural and lacks extensive public transit options. Parking is primarily found in the school's dedicated lots or along the adjacent street, which is generally ample even during busy events. The closest major airport is Hays Regional Airport, located about 15 minutes to the west, providing convenient access for those flying into the region.

Navigating the area is straightforward due to the small-town layout and grid-based street system. Rideshare services are limited in this rural setting, so having a personal or team vehicle is highly recommended for all visitors. During high-traffic events, simply follow the local signage and be mindful of school zone speed limits near the campus. Arriving at least 30 minutes before your scheduled start time is a smart tactic to secure a convenient parking spot. Visitors should note that the neighborhood is quiet and residential, so please respect local property and traffic flow when entering and exiting the school vicinity.

5–15 Minutes Away

Sternberg Museum of Natural History

12.5 mi

Located in nearby Hays, this museum features fascinating exhibits on the prehistoric life of Kansas, including impressive fossil displays. It is a highly educational stop that offers a refreshing change of pace for families and teams looking for an indoor activity. The exhibits are well-curated and provide insight into the unique geological history of the Great Plains region. Plan for about two hours to fully appreciate the collections and interactive displays available for all ages.

Fort Hays State Historic Site

13.2 mi

This historic site offers a deep dive into the frontier history of Kansas, featuring original buildings and informative displays. Visitors can explore the grounds and learn about the soldiers and pioneers who shaped the region's development during the 19th century. It is a spacious outdoor area that provides plenty of room to roam and learn, making it a great stop for groups. The site is well-maintained and offers a quiet, historical perspective on the surrounding landscape.
